Location: Cardiff, Wales Do you enjoy socialising and meeting new people? We are looking for friendly volunteers who love a d ance and would like to join us as at Friendship Disco on the second Saturday of the month . Activities will include:
Supporting the Disco at the following times:
- S et up between 16:00-17:00 ( H elp with the music equipment, tables , decorations etc )
- D uring the disco between 17:00-20:00 . (H elp sell ing raffle tickets and refreshments, taking song requests on a phone, call ing the raffle at the end ). Plus j oining in with dancing and helping everyone to have a great time !
- C lean up between 20:00-21:00 . H elp ing to wipe and take down tables, floors, etc).
You will have the flexibi li ty to attend the times that are convenient to you . The Disco will take place at Marshfield Village Hall in Cardiff.
